“Tracker! Rex!”

The pups bombard themselves on top of the pair. Clearly they were excited to see their friends again.

“Whoa! So glad to see you all!” Rex beamed.

“Si, Los Amigos y Amiga.” He winked towards Skye. Getting a giggle out of her.

“I hope things weren’t too dull without the rest of us around.” Rocky asked.

“Oi, no. The Dino wilds are so much fun. Rex has been showing me everything about dinosaurs living here.”

He did his best not to blush in front of them but he had a feeling Skye might have picked up on it.

“Well, Glad our Dino friend could got you well acquainted” said a voice behind the group.

“Ryder!” They both said in unison.

“Hey guys, Great to see ya. Have either of you seen Carlos? I sent him a message of us heading over today but he hasn’t responded back.”

“Hmmm that’s bizarre.”

Tracker clicked his pup tag.

“Carlos to Tracker! Carlos. Can you hear me?”

No response came from his tag. Carlos hadn’t said anything since last night. Tracker let out a small whimper of concern. With Rex putting a paw on his back.

“I’m sure he’s just distracted by the ruins we found. Maybe just studying them more.”

“Exactly.” Ryder reassured. “Tell you what, I’ll catch up with Dr. Turbot and we’ll both go check it out in a little bit.”

“Yeah! In the meantime, You can show us all the fun stuff you two have been doing!” Chase asked.

“Any new little cutie Dinos we can see?” Rubble added.

“Oh don’t worry ya’ll. We got plenty to see, Right Tracker buddy?”

Trackers worry had been put at ease for now. He leaned into Rex softly.

“Si, Lots to check out.”



As he promised, Ryder left with Dr.Turbot on her ATV to see the sight. Taylor had stayed behind to watch the other dinosaurs. In the meantime, The eight pups spent the next few hours hopping between activities. From saying hi to a few Dinos by the watering hole to carefully observing eggs that were incubating in the clinic. Tracker was eager to have the other pups around. It helped him think a little more clearly regarding certain feelings he was having. Those feelings were amplified with the occasion high paw or brush against Rex. The Bernese mountain dog seeming to appreciate the affection. Tracker was sure not to make his feelings too obvious for the other pups. Neither being wise to the cockapoo that had noticed the flirty behavior between them.

“Ya’ll want to play some Duck Duck, Dino?” Zuma asked. He wagged his tail and bent down in a play bow towards the others. The crew having begun to set up their tents outside the paddock.

“Ohhh I love that game!” Marshall beamed. Leaving Chase to the roll out their sleeping bag. Chase smiling and rolling his eyes at his partners eagerness.

“Isn’t that just Duck Duck Goose but we make dinosaur noises?” Rocky raised an eye brow at the lab. He just about finished putting up their double bedded tent.

“Yup, But it’s a lot more fun that way.” He walked towards the recycle pup. Leaning in close. “Afraid will get caught by the big bad Dino?” He gently raked his canine teeth against Rocky’s nose. The mixed breed turning his head way in embarrassment.

“Zuma! Hahaha!”

“Jeez don’t tease him so bad Zuma.” Chase said. Finishing his set up and sitting next to Marshall. “I can’t imagine doing that to a pup. Especially a black spotted one.”

Chase began to lean himself against the dalmatian. Letting his full weight press against him as Marshall struggled to keep up right.

“Welp, Duck...Duck...Plop!”

The pup fell over, Content on having his boyfriend nestled cozily on top of him. Getting a laugh out of the others.
 
“As much as I’d like to play, There’s a few a few pterodactyl babies near by I wanted to check on.” Rex said.  “Skye, Care to join me?”

The cockapoo yipped.

“Most definitely! We can use my Dino jet to get there.”

“Rubble? Wanna join?”

“Nah, Got to make sure these four love birds play the game right. Hehehe.”

“Tracker?”

The chihuahua stared at Rex. Feeling like he could stare into his friends eyes for days. He quickly shook himself out of it and made a difficult decision.

“Lo siento. I’m going to stay here too.”

“Oh, Alright.” Rex said, His mood deflating a little.

“Don’t worry! We’ll be back soon!” Skye added. “I’ll be sure to bring him back in one piece!”

 The two made their way towards the Dino tower. Tracker sat with the five remaining boys and watched the plane get set for take off before flying towards the cliffs. He hoped Rex was looking back at him too. He didn’t really engage with the other pups in their game. The boys had gone a few rounds of Duck, Duck, Dino. Rubble and Chase had just finished their run with the shepherd obviously picking Marshall next. He sat down fast, Winking at the dalmatian who stuck his tongue out in a coy but flirty response.

“Duck, Duck, Duck…”

The dalmatian quietly slipped passed Zuma before stepping next to Chase again. Rocky shook his head at the teasing pair.

“Duck…”

Marshall moved on and brushed his paw against Tracker’s ears. Snapping him out of his daze.

“Dino!”

“I have a crush on Rex!”

“Huh?!” The boys called out in unison. Marshall taking a few steps before tripping over himself and landing on Zuma.

“Ouch Dude..”

“Sorry!” Marshall said. “What was that Tracker?”

 The jungle pup covered his snout in embarrassment. He could not believe he had blurted that out. The pair picked themselves back up and joined the boys around Tracker.

“Awww, That’s so cute!” Rubble replied.

“No, That’s bad. I think?” Tracker squeaked.

“Dude, How could that be bad?”

“Because I think I’m falling for him too fast. We only met a few days ago after all. How do I know I’m just not trying to rush into a relationship?”

Tracker began to pace in place.

“Oi,Oi,Oi!”

“Crushes are different for all pups Tracker.” Rocky said. “I can tell you it was weird realizing I had something for Zuma.”

“Yeah but it’s not like we haven’t seen you two being together for a while now” Rubble admitted.

Rocky stared dead pan while Zuma’s jaw dropped.

“Dude, You hadn’t realized me and Rocky were a couple till the following morning!”

“We had told everyone the night prior!”

“I was..distracted! That was a crazy night!”

The boys laughed but Tracker still seemed tense.

“I just...don’t want to mess this new friendship up.”

Marshall walked over and placed a paw on his shoulder.

“I know exactly how you felt. Believe me, I nearly swallowed my tongue when I told Chase how I felt.”

“Really caught me by surprise then.” Chase added.

  “You two seem pretty close already since we’ve arrived. If your already this close with Rex, I’m sure it will be fine.”

“Whoa whoa, Hold on there.” Chase said. “Have you even asked him if he felt the same way?”

Tracker looked down at his front paws.

“No, Not exactly.”

“Well that would be a great place to start.” Marshall assured.

Tracker gnawed on his lower lip, his ears flicking nervously.

“Gracias Marshall but this is based on assumption. I don’t even know if he likes boys that way. I doubt he does.”



“Sooo, How long have you been crushing on Tracker?” Skye raised an eyebrow at Rex.

The pup froze in place. The curious pterodactyl he was admiring squawked and softly pressed it’s beak against Rex. The pup coming back to his senses and giving it a pet.

“Ugh, Is it that obvious?”

Skye rolled her eyes.

“Rex, I live with six guys. Two of them having obvious crushes on each other. Plus I helped Chase figure himself out with Marshall. Safe to say I can spot romance when I can see it.”

Rex bit his lips at the thought.

“Romance huh? Heh. I don’t know if I ‘d go that far but...I definitely feel something.”

Skye settled on the ground, A paw keeping her head up.

“Come on. Spill it.”

Rex sighed, knowing he couldn’t talk himself out of this one. He laid down in front of her.

“I’ve never felt this way for other pup before. I’m not really around others too often so that doesn’t mean a whole lot but He and I are kind of similar ya know? Not so much just having a love for dinosaurs but nature entirely.”

“Tracker is such an outdoorsy pup like you. We always learn something new when we visit him.”

“Must be fun seeing the jungle where he comes from.”

“Yeah, but we aren’t always available to stop by. Tracker doesn’t admit it but I think he can get a little lonely sometimes. Sounds like something else you have in common with him.”

Rex half smiled at that.

“I guess so. Issue is, I can’t tell if he wants something more or if he just wants another friend.”

“Oh, that boy would go nuts for a boyfriend.”

Rex blushed at the thought. It’s not something he had ever consider before. Yeah he could feel isolated out here in the Dino wilds but was he craving something more than friendship this whole time?

“You think so?”

“I would go far to say that I know so and if your comfortable with it. I think you should pursue it. Slowly if you want.”

A few loud squawks came from the pterodactyls near them. Who seemed to be giving encouragement to the pup. Or they just wanted more Dino treats.

“ Where do I even start? Do I just tell him? Hey Tracker! I know we just met but I might have crush on you!”

Skye’s eyes lit up.

“Dio’s Mio Rex, Sweep me off my feet!”

“Hahaahh” He rolled his eyes.

Skye walked towards the pup and held one of his paws.

“In all serious Rex, You never know till you ask. I think it’s good to be direct. That way no pup is strung along with expectations. Tracker seems to really like you though. Maybe the last few days have been a real experience for him.”

“They have been. I feel so different now.” Rex stood up, coming to a realization. “He and Carlos only have a few days here to study the ruins. I should say something before...”


A devastating Roar echoed through the forest floor and along the cliffs. The small pterodactyls recoiled in fear.
“What was that?!”

Rex listened closely. Trying his best to translate but came to a frightening realization.

“I...I have no idea. I’ve never heard that type of Dinosaur before.”

Their pup tags beeped.

“Ryder to pups! Ryder to pups! Emergency! I need all of you to come down to the ruins with your vehicles! No time for a lookout briefing!”

Skye and Rex bolted from their positions and ran towards Skye’s jet.



On the other side of the wilds. Chase replied back to his tag.
“Ruff! Roger Ryder!”

The pups ran to the Dino tower. As Tracker ran along with them, he noticed a ATV bolting towards the clinic. It was Dr. Turbot and someone else straddled  His heart dropping at the sight .

“Carlos!”

Tracker stopped in his tracks and run towards the pair. The others taking notice and following the long eared pup. Dr Turbot saw the worry on Trackers face as they came to a stop.

“It’s ok Tracker. Carlos is just a little hurt.”

“Ye...Yeah. No problem! Ugh!”

Carlos slowly lifted of the ATV. The doctor quickly wrapping an arm around him. Tracker was almost in tears and quickly leaned himself against him. Noticing how his leg didn’t touch the ground.

“Marshall sweetie. Get your EMS gear please. I’ll have Carlos lay in a cot inside. We’ll need to make a splint for his leg.

“Arf! On my way!”

The other pups whined and pressed themselves next to Carlos. Chase bit his lip, He hate seeing his friends hurt but he knew they had a job to do.

“Pups, Ryder needs us. Marshall and Dr.Turbot can sit Carlos. We need to get a move on!”

“Right!” Rocky and Zuma said.

“On it!” Rubble added. The three ran towards the tower with Chase nudging Tracker.

“Tracker, We have to go.”

“No way! I’m not leaving Carlos!”

“Tracker…”

The pup felt a hand gently pet his forehead.

“I’ll be fine, really. Dr. Turbot and Marshall will take care of me. You gotta help Ryder. Find Rex and Warn him.”
“Warn them about what?”

Dr. Turbot solemnly looked at the two pups before answering.

“Tell them there’s an unknown dinosaur in the ruins.”


Rex and Skye had landed near by what remained of the sight. The large stone carvings were shattered and ripped from the ground. Vines and foliage torn and thrown all about. The only thing not touched were the fossils that laid engraved in the dirt. The safety tape surrounding the excavation site had been dragged away.

“What in the world?"

“Ryder?!” Rex called out.

The pair heard the roar again, it echoed loudly from the opening of the ruins before something tremendous began to stomp towards them. It’s scaly dark red body towered the biggest T-rex they had seen. Three long claws curved downwards from it’s hands. A long and brittle looking flat spine run from the start of it’s neck towards the base of it’s tail. Like a massive fin. It’s snout elongated and filled with a row of sharp teeth that protruded from it’s top jaw. Rex couldn’t believe what he was looking at.

“It can’t be...It’s not.”

“Rex! What type of dinosaur is that.”

What caught him most were the eyes. A bright shade of green met his gaze of brown. Rex felt his front paws shake at the familiar sight.

“Spinosaurus.”

The beast roared a guttural sound and charged towards the pair.
